Identifying Authentic Louis Vuitton: A Holistic Approach
Authenticating a Louis Vuitton shirt isn't a simple yes or no process; it requires a multi-faceted approach, examining various aspects of the garment. Rushing to judgment based on a single detail can lead to inaccurate conclusions. Instead, consider the following factors cumulatively to build a comprehensive assessment:
1. The Monogram Canvas (if applicable): Many Louis Vuitton shirts feature the iconic monogram canvas. Counterfeiters often struggle to replicate the precise details of this pattern. Look for:
* Clarity and Sharpness: The monogram should be crisply printed, with clear lines and evenly spaced elements. Blurry or uneven printing is a major red flag.
* Color Consistency: The colors used in the monogram should be consistent throughout the shirt. Variations in shading or discoloration indicate a fake.
* Texture and Feel: Authentic Louis Vuitton canvas possesses a distinct texture – a subtle stiffness and a slight graininess. Counterfeits often feel flimsy or overly stiff.
* Registration: The alignment of the monogram pattern across seams should be precise. Misalignment suggests a poorly made counterfeit.
2. Stitching and Construction: Louis Vuitton is renowned for its meticulous craftsmanship. Examine the stitching carefully:
* Evenness and Consistency: The stitching should be perfectly even and consistent throughout the garment. Uneven stitches, skipped stitches, or loose threads are clear indicators of a fake.
* Stitch Type: Pay attention to the type of stitch used. Louis Vuitton typically employs high-quality stitching techniques, often with a specific stitch density and pattern.
* Seam Finish: The seams should be neatly finished, with no loose threads or frayed edges. Rough or unfinished seams are a telltale sign of a counterfeit.
3. Hardware (Buttons, Zippers, etc.): The hardware on a genuine Louis Vuitton shirt will be of superior quality:
* Metal Finish: The metal should have a smooth, consistent finish, free from scratches or discoloration. Cheap-looking or tarnished metal is a common characteristic of fakes.
* Engraving: Any engravings on the hardware (e.g., the Louis Vuitton logo) should be crisp and clearly defined. Blurred or poorly executed engravings are a strong indication of a counterfeit.
* Weight and Feel: Authentic Louis Vuitton hardware feels substantial and weighty. Counterfeit hardware often feels lightweight and flimsy.
